Holiday cottages in Shropshire

Halfway along the English and Welsh border or Marches, Shropshire is a beautiful county with outstanding countryside. The River Severn meanders through from the Welsh mountains down to the flatter lands where it creates some excellent ox bow lakes. To the western side of Shropshire lies the hills around Carding Mill valley, nestling upon the village of Church Stretton, known locally as little Switzerland. The Long Mynd is a popular Gliding centre as well as a walking and cycling centre. Further South towards Clun, the county really is rural and you can really feel far from it all.

There are some really picturesque villages and towns with lovely houses, cottages, churches and of course pubs! The main county town is Shrewsbury - a medieval town full of historic buildings, surrounded by the Severn. Why stay in shropshire?

Shropshire is a remarkable county that offers some of the UK’s most impressive attractions, such as the Ironbridge Gorge, a UNESCO World Heritage Site. Outdoor enthusiasts will feel right at home in the Shropshire Hills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ty, which covers about a quarter of the region.
